How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Seven Isles?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Seven Isles Studio Apartments | $2,394 | $1,300 | $5,007 |
Seven Isles 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,838 | $1,395 | $6,590 |
Seven Isles 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,000 | $1,600 | $10,000+ |
Seven Isles 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,616 | $2,300 | $10,000+ |
Seven Isles 4 Bedroom Apartments | $8,580 | $3,000 | $10,000+ |

Getting Around the Seven Isles Neighborhood in Fort Lauderdale, FL
Walk Score®
20 / 100
Car-Dependent
Almost all errands require a car
Bike Score®
35 / 100
Somewhat Bikeable
Minimal bike infrastructure
Transit Score®
28 / 100
Some Transit
A few nearby public transportation options
